Cream of Asparagus Soup

This soup is smooth, velvety, and packed with the flavor of fresh asparagus. It’s easy to make and perfect for a light lunch or starter. The key ingredients include fresh asparagus, onion, garlic, vegetable broth, and a splash of cream for richness. Garnish with a sprig of dill or a drizzle of olive oil for added elegance.

  • Fresh asparagus
  • Onion and garlic
  • Vegetable broth
  • Heavy cream or coconut milk
  • Salt and pepper
  • Dill or chives for garnish

To prepare, sauté onion and garlic until fragrant, add chopped asparagus and cook briefly. Pour in broth and simmer until tender. Blend until smooth, stir in cream, and season to taste. Serve hot with a garnish of dill for a spring-inspired touch.

Lemon Dill Pasta Salad

This vibrant pasta salad is a perfect side dish or light main course. The zesty lemon and fresh dill give it a springtime flair, while the pasta provides satisfying carbs. It’s easy to prepare ahead of time, making it ideal for picnics or potlucks.

  • Cooked pasta (penne or fusilli)
  • Fresh dill and parsley
  • Juice and zest of lemon
  • Olive oil
  • Cherry tomatoes and cucumber (optional)
  • Feta cheese (optional)

Mix cooked pasta with lemon juice, zest, chopped herbs, and olive oil. Add chopped vegetables or feta for extra flavor. Chill in the refrigerator before serving to let flavors meld. This salad pairs beautifully with grilled chicken or fish for a complete spring meal.

Pairing Tips and Serving Ideas

Serve the Cream of Asparagus Soup warm or chilled, depending on your preference. It pairs well with crusty bread or a light salad. The Lemon Dill Pasta Salad can be served cold or at room temperature, making it versatile for outdoor dining.

For a balanced spring menu, consider adding fresh fruit or a light dessert like lemon sorbet. These dishes are also excellent for meal prep, allowing you to enjoy spring flavors throughout the week.
